Russian President Vladimir Putin, commenting on the plans of the Ukrainian authorities to create nuclear weapons, said that such statements are not empty bravado. This opinion was expressed by the head of state on Monday, February 21, in an address to the Russians.

“Ukraine’s threat to create its own nuclear weapons is not empty bravado. Ukraine really still has Soviet nuclear technologies and means of delivering such weapons, including aviation, as well as Tochka-U operational-tactical missiles, also of Soviet design, whose range exceeds 100 km, but they will do more, it’s only a matter of time. There are backlogs from the Soviet era,” the Russian leader said.

Putin added that it would be much easier for Ukraine than for some other states to acquire tactical nuclear weapons. He noted that technological support from abroad will especially contribute to this.

The Russian president emphasized the danger of Ukraine having weapons of mass destruction, as this would lead to a fundamental change in the situation in Europe and the world.

“With the appearance of weapons of mass destruction in Ukraine, the situation in the world, in Europe, especially for us, for Russia, will change in the most radical way, we cannot but respond to this real danger. Moreover, I repeat that Western patrons can contribute to the emergence of such weapons in Ukraine in order to create another threat to our country, ”Putin said.
